Famille Ricci OVNI 7
The rum was selected and bottled by the independent bottler Famille Ricci. It was distilled with a Pot and Column Still and then aged for 19 years - 24 years. The rum has an ABV of 50,2%. 6 community members rated this rum with an average of 8.5/10. The rum smells like Cherry, Barrel and Gooseberry, and on the palate there is Barrel, Cherry and Caramelized.

Very nice butter and cherry note as well as subtle wood and spice, seems very round and balanced. I like it very much! However, this rum would certainly have benefited from a few more revolutions. Release price is a bit of a deterrent.
The two rums seem to tame rather than develop each other. The result is also easy to drink thanks to the reduced strength, fruit meets wood and spices and light roasted aromas. Pleasant release.
